John L. Parker, Jr. is the writer of the cult classic "Once A Runner" and a more recently published "Again to Carthage". Cassidy, a passionate, obsessive runner, is first introduced in "Once A Runner", published in 1978. Thirty years later Parker follows the career of Cassidy in a second book "Again to Carthage", published in late 2007. In "Once a Runner" Cassidy is an elite college athlete who is suspended from school and prohibited from competing in his university's track meets. He trains in private hoping to compete in disguise. In "Again to Carthage," ten years have passed for Cassidy. After taking a break from running, he begins training again in earnest trying to recapture the feeling and the glory of the past, this time through long distance running. While neither book ever acquired literary acclaim, Parker -- and Quenton Cassidy -- achieved a cult following among readers in the running community.

Parker attended the University of Florida. While enrolled he was a runner on the track team.
